US stock surge as investors reflect on current trends

https://images.wsj.net/im-120425/?width=700&height=467

The U.S. stock market saw a significant rise lately, with investors closely analyzing new economic information and the potential effects of policies from Donald Trump’s administration. This renewed confidence in the markets underscores the delicate interplay between economic factors and political changes, both essential in influencing investor attitudes.

The surge in U.S. stocks is mainly due to investor responses to important economic indicators hinting that the economy might be stabilizing. Data on employment numbers, consumer expenditure, and industrial production have created a mixed yet hopeful outlook. Although certain industries still encounter difficulties, others display resilience, leading market players to modify their portfolios in expectation of future expansion.

Beyond the economic figures, policies from Trump’s presidency continue to notably impact the stock market. Several of these measures, like tax reforms and deregulation initiatives, aimed to invigorate economic activity and enhance corporate earnings. Investors are still evaluating the lasting results of these actions, yet their immediate effect is clear in the performance of specific industries. Areas such as energy, finance, and manufacturing have especially gained from deregulation, boosting traders’ confidence.

Interestingly, the surge also showcases the stock market’s capacity to adjust to uncertainty. Recent worldwide events, including geopolitical strains and changes in trade deals, have introduced complications to the investment environment. Nonetheless, the strength of U.S. equities indicates that investors prioritize core elements like corporate profits and economic stability, rather than being heavily swayed by external disturbances.

At the same time, financial stocks recorded increases, driven by anticipated stable interest rates and enhanced bank profitability. The financial industry has been heavily linked to policy shifts in the past years, with deregulation offering advantages to organizations that depend on reduced regulatory limitations to grow their activities. Investors regard these changes as encouraging signs for the sector’s long-term growth potential.

However, it’s not just policy and data that are influencing the markets. Investor psychology plays a pivotal role in driving stock movements. Optimism about future growth, combined with a willingness to take on more risk, has contributed to the rally. When economic data aligns with expectations, it often reinforces market confidence, creating a feedback loop that drives stocks higher. This phenomenon is evident in the current market climate, where positive sentiment appears to be outweighing lingering uncertainties.

In the future, market participants will probably focus intently on forthcoming economic reports and policy updates. The Federal Reserve’s position on interest rates will be especially influential in shaping investor actions. Any indications concerning inflation, monetary tightening, or possible rate cuts could create ripple effects across the markets, affecting both short-term shifts and long-term investment approaches.

At present, the U.S. stock market seems to be experiencing a phase of cautious optimism. As investors assess the interaction between economic data and policy effects, the upswing highlights the dynamic elements that influence financial markets. Although uncertainties persist, the robustness of U.S. equities emphasizes the ongoing attraction of the stock market as an indicator of economic well-being and a catalyst for wealth generation.
